Force Conversion Calculator for Structural Engineering 2026
Kilonewtons (kN) represent SI force unit essential structural engineering with 1kN=1000N equivalent 102kgf vertical Earth gravity. Metric ton-force (tf) equals 9.80665kN representing 1000kg weight while imperial ton-force (tonf) 9.96402kN 2240lb mass. Construction tolerances ±5% standard ensuring safe load transfer across calculations preventing cumulative errors design verification.
Structural design utilises kN precision though site documentation converts tons simplifying communication crane capacities scaffolding ratings. Column loads 500-2000kN translate 51-204tf metric critical foundation reactions pile schedules ensuring compatibility equipment specifications throughout construction sequence.
1kN = 0.10197 metric tf, 0.10036 imperial tonf, 0.11240 US short tonf with 5% tolerance acceptable engineering drawings. Reverse conversions multiply by 9.80665 metric tons, 9.96402 imperial ensuring consistency calculations across international projects mixed documentation standards.
Crane lift capacities specify metric tons safe working load with 500tf=4903kN verifying structural adequacy. Scaffolding ratings 4.0kN/m² convert 0.41tf/m² confirming platform loading. Precast concrete elements 20-100tf delivered 196-981kN matching lifting insert capacities preventing installation failures.
BS EN 1990 partial factors apply 1.35 permanent, 1.5 imposed loads converting safely across units maintaining reliability indices. Construction tolerances ±5% prevent cumulative discrepancies drawings site execution ensuring designed capacities achieved without systematic underestimation.
| kN | Metric tf | Imperial tonf | US Short tonf |
|---|---|---|---|
| 10 | 1.02 | 1.00 | 1.12 |
| 50 | 5.10 | 5.02 | 5.62 |
| 100 | 10.20 | 10.04 | 11.24 |
| 500 | 51.00 | 50.18 | 56.20 |
| 1000 | 102.0 | 100.4 | 112.4 |
| 2000 | 204.0 | 200.7 | 224.8 |
| Application | Typical Load | kN | Metric tf |
|---|---|---|---|
| Column Reaction | Medium | 500-1500 | 51-153 |
| Crane Lift | Precast | 200-1000 | 20-102 |
| Scaffold Rating | Platform | 4kN/m² | 0.41tf/m² |
| Pile Capacity | Driven | 1000-4000 | 102-408 |
